    摘要: A binary image reducing method is so adapted that image reduction in which the occurrence of discontinuous lines is eliminated, is made possible even when there is a change in the reduction magnification of an image containing many lines of one-pixel width and characters or the like composed of line elements having a width of one to several pixels, such as an image created by a computer. First, an original image is subjected to enlargement processing by a micro-enlarging circuit, whereby the image is enlarged by 2.times.p (where, and the reduction ratio is p). Thereafter, 1/2 reduction processing, of the type which preserves fine lines, is executed by a 1/2 reducing circuit. As a result, it is possible to achieve a change in reduction at any desired magnification of 1/2-1 as well as preservation of fine lines in the reduced image obtained. In another embodiment, an original image is subjected to enlargement processing by a micro-enlarging circuit, after which reduction processing, of a type which preserves fine lines, is executed by a repetitive reducing circuit in response to a command from a decision unit. As a result, it is possible to achieve a change in reduction at any desired magnification of 0.about.1 as well as preservation of fine lines in the reduced image obtained.
